Frito-Lay is recalling a limited number of Tostitos tortilla chips because they may contain undeclared milk. The company said Wednesday that the recall includes less than 1,300 13-ounce bags of ...

The recall does not impact any other Tostitos products, the company said. Frito-Lay has recalled some of its 13 oz. bags of Tostitos Cantina Traditional Yellow Corn Tortilla Chips on March 26, 2025.
